Social Worker II
Your Opportunity:
Working collaboratively and as part of a multidisciplinary team, the Social Worker II works in a fast-paced environment to provide Social Work supports to patients and families who are receiving service within the ICU and Emergency Departments. Services include psychosocial assessment, crisis intervention, education, treatment, advocacy, resource finding, and consultation, making appropriate referrals both internal and external to the hospital and liaising with community agencies/programs. The Social Worker participates in non-patient care activities such as program planning, evaluation, quality improvement research and staff development, along with other duties as required. Please note this position is on a 5 on and 5 off rotation this includes weekends and long weekends.
Description:
As a Social Worker II, you will be a member of an inter-disciplinary team and provides a range of social work services to patients and their families. Your services may include: psychosocial assessment, resource-based interventions, individual, group and family treatment, risk screening, counselling, case management and coordination, transition or discharge planning, and prevention, promotion and public awareness activities.

Completion of bachelor's degree in Social Work. Active or eligible for registration with the Alberta College of Social Workers (ACSW).
Additional Required Qualifications:Minimum 2 years of experience. This position requires a high degree of independence, critical thinking, problem-solving skills, and an ability to prioritize workload. Knowledge and ability to use computer applications such as Microsoft Office, Outlook and Teams is highly recommended. Previous experience working in the health care system is an asset.
Preferred Qualifications:Knowledge of trauma informed practice, grief and loss, crisis intervention. Knowledge of connect care.
